Drive Test Summary
• Conducted on 8/29/23
• Three Samsung S22 phones,
one each from AT&T, T-Mobile,
and Verizon
• Includes 2+ hours of driving,
plus a tour of Hudson National
Golf Course
• Data processed into grids for
localized summarization
• Used Televate’s Pinpoint™
software to collect and analyze
the data

Southeast Village View
• DPW Yard may* provide
some help to Bungalow,
Radnor, and Riverside Road
• Highly variable signals due to
terrain (requires propagation
analysis for each site)
• Nordica / Truesdale Drive
likely difficult to cover from
existing sites (potentially
small cell or from adjacent
jurisdiction)
* Requires a propagation study. Is not expected to help given proximity of Veterans Plaza and the geometry

Other Thoughts/Recommendations
• Public safety service could be enhanced using some of these sites as
well (unknown, did not measure or analyze). May represent a Village
liability because police and fire can’t communicate* at some locations
• Recommend Village immediately conducts a public safety coverage study to
better understand what potential sites could play a dual public safety/cellular role
• There are many weak coverage areas in the Village – will require many
sites to serve, the few macro sites included in this analysis are
insufficient to address all issues uncovered and may require small cells
• AT&T and T-Mobile could use the Danish Home site to improve service
in NE
• Sites in this rough terrain are serving a very limited distance, and
therefore, you should be cautious about applying generalized
requirements about distance to alternative sites. E.G.,
• No service in Village from Yorktown Road site (1 mile outside of Village)
• Poor service levels within 0.25 miles of Van Wyck
*Per EMS statement at kickoff meeting
